Time to lower minrelaytxfee ? [combined summary]



Individual post summaries: Click here to read the original discussion on the bitcoin-dev mailing list

Published on: 2020-08-21T16:57:32+00:00


Summary:

The bitcoin-dev mailing list recently discussed the possibility of reducing the minimum relay transaction fee (minrelaytxfee) on the Bitcoin network. The current fee, which was set five years ago when Bitcoin was trading at $255, is 1000 sat/vkB. However, some argue that this fee is too high and a reduction to as low as 22 sat/vKB would be more appropriate. The proposed reduction is driven by the need for ultra-low-fee on-chain transactions due to growing adoption of the Lightning Network.While it is acknowledged that reducing the minrelaytxfee could make denial of service attacks cheaper, proponents argue that thoroughly testing any changes can prevent bugs that could cause issues on the peer-to-peer network. The discussion also referenced previous pull requests (#13922 and #13990) related to reducing the minrelaytxfee.The concern raised is that having large portions of the network using a different minrelayfee could make it easier to double-spend unconfirmed non-rbf transactions. Node operators that accept unconfirmed payments with a minrelayfee higher than what other nodes/miners are typically accepting would be at risk. Although relying on unconfirmed transactions is discouraged, this potential issue is worth considering.Dan Bryant suggests further reducing the minrelaytxfee to allow for ultra-low-fee on-chain transactions, which are needed for the growing adoption of the Lightning Network. He proposes reducing the fee to 22 sat/vkB, but notes that a conservative reduction to 100 or 50 sat/vkB would also be welcome. Two years ago, there was a pull request to reduce the fee from 1000 to 200 sat/vkB, but it was eventually closed in favor of another pull request.Bryant questions why changing the default minrelaytxfee would be detrimental to node operation if it is already parameterized and configurable in bitcoin.conf. He provides various reference links, including the commit for lowering the minrelaytxfee, the pull requests for further fee reductions, and the need for ultra-low fee transactions to accommodate the growth of the Lightning Network.Overall, the discussion revolves around the possibility of reducing the minimum relay transaction fee on the Bitcoin network. While some argue for a significant reduction to facilitate ultra-low-fee on-chain transactions for the Lightning Network, concerns about potential risks and double-spending vulnerabilities are also raised. Despite being configurable in bitcoin.conf, the impact of changing the default minrelaytxfee on node operation is still uncertain. The reference links provided offer more information on the topic.


Updated on: 2023-08-02T02:38:28.855383+00:00